Output 5eb609736e5760012498ad23ac4d9849e8451142f6c7aa58217af7e0cfd2c697:60

value
3650673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23555dd68f66b4b0bf51a95acd7b9c4d320a8011 OP_EQUAL
address
34uqqdVmBoB5KgM8JiVroNdJcJY16LgQ4N
transaction
5eb609736e5760012498ad23ac4d9849e8451142f6c7aa58217af7e0cfd2c697
spent
true